Ukrainian forces destroy Russian bridge-laying vehicle on Vovchansk front
The Defense Forces of Ukraine have destroyed a Russian bridge-laying vehicle in the Vovchansk area, after it was deployed in an attempt to cross the Vovcha River and transport military equipment.
This was reported by the Joint Forces Group on Telegram, according to Ukrinform, along with published video footage.
According to the statement, Russian engineering units attempted to use a VMM-3M to establish a crossing over the river.
“The enemy’s goal was to enable the passage of armored and motor vehicles to expand their offensive operations. However, thanks to mine-explosive barriers and precise strikes by our UAVs, the enemy equipment was completely destroyed. The Defense Forces maintain strong control over the area,” the military said.
As previously reported by Ukrinform, fighters of the Volkodavy battalion of the 57th Separate Motorized Infantry Brigade of the Ukrainian Armed Forces struck a truck converted by Russian forces into a pontoon platform intended for river crossing operations.
